码迷,mamicode.com
首页 > 数据库 > 详细

SQLite 粗劣内容

时间:2016-04-09 11:59:35      阅读:157      评论:0      收藏:0      [点我收藏+]

标签:

SQLite 的官网

http://addons.mozillan.org/firefox/addon/sqlite-manager/

http://www.sqlite.org

 

sqlite3 *sqlite = nil;

    

    NSString *filePath = [NSHomeDirectory() stringByAppendingPathComponent:@"Documents/data.file" ];

    

    //打开数据库

    int result  = sqlite3_open([filePath  UTF8String], &sqlite);

    if (result !=SQLITE_OK) {

        NSLog(@"创建失败!!!");

        return ;

    }

    

    //创建表的SQL语句

    

    NSString *sql = @"CREATE TABLE IF NOT EXISTS UserTable(userName text PRIMARY KEY ,password text,email text)";

    //执行SQL语句

    char *error;

    result = sqlite3_exec(sqlite, [sql  UTF8String], NULL, NULL, &error);

    if (result != SQLITE_OK) {

        NSLog(@"创建数据库失败:%s",error);

        return ;

    }

    //插如入一条数据

    //INSERT OR REPLACE INTO UserTable (userName,password,email) VALUES(?,?,?);

    //更新一条数据

    //UPDATE UserTable set password = ‘‘ where userName = ‘‘;

    

    //查询数据

    

    //SELECT userName ,password,eamil FROM UserTable where username = ‘‘;

   

    //删除数据

   // DELETE FROM UserTable WHERE username =‘‘;

    

    //关闭数据库

    

    sqlite3_close(sqlite);

SQLite 粗劣内容

标签:

原文地址:http://www.cnblogs.com/meixian/p/5371114.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!